Lamons v. United States of America
Plaintiff: Robert Charles Lamons
Defendant: United States of America
Case Number: 1:2019cv24135
Filed: October 4, 2019
Court: US District Court for the Southern District of Florida
Presiding Judge: Lisette M Reid
Referring Judge: Patricia A Seitz
Nature of Suit: Prisoner: Vacate Sentence
Cause of Action: 28 U.S.C. ยง 2255
Jury Demanded By: None

Date Filed Document Text
November 20, 2019 Opinion or Order Filing 7 ORDER TO SHOW CAUSE 28 U.S.C. 2255. On or before thirty days from the date of this order, the respondent shall file a memorandum of fact and law to show cause why this motion should not be granted and shall file therewith all documents and transcripts necessary for the resolution of this motion regardless of whether or not they are in the Court file. Signed by Magistrate Judge Lisette M. Reid on 11/20/2019. See attached document for full details. (fbn)
November 15, 2019 Filing 6 RESPONSE TO ORDER TO SHOW CAUSE by United States of America. (Haggerty, T)
October 16, 2019 Filing 5 NOTICE of Attorney Appearance by T Haggerty on behalf of United States of America. Attorney T Haggerty added to party United States of America(pty:dft). (Haggerty, T)
October 15, 2019 Opinion or Order Filing 4 LIMITED ORDER TO SHOW CAUSE - 28 U.S.C. 2255 REGARDING TIMELINESS OF MOTION TO VACATE. On or before November 15, 2019, Respondent shall file a response to this show cause order regarding its position on the timeliness of this federal motion. Show Cause Response due by 11/15/2019. Signed by Magistrate Judge Lisette M. Reid on 10/15/2019. See attached document for full details. (fbn)
October 15, 2019 Opinion or Order Filing 3 INITIAL ORDER OF INSTRUCTIONS TO PRO SE LITIGANT. Signed by Magistrate Judge Lisette M. Reid on 10/15/2019. See attached document for full details. (fbn)
October 4, 2019 Filing 2 Clerks Notice of Judge Assignment to Senior Judge Patricia A. Seitz and Magistrate Judge Lisette M. Reid. Pursuant to Administrative Order 2019-2, this matter is referred to the Magistrate Judge for a ruling on all pre-trial, non-dispositive matters and for a Report and Recommendation on any dispositive matters. (ebz)
October 4, 2019 Filing 1 MOTION (Complaint) to Vacate Sentence (2255). NOTE: All further docketing is to be done in the civil case. (Criminal Case # 03-cr-20906-PAS), filed by Robert Charles Lamons.(ebz)
